TPSI2260-Q1 Reinforced Solid-State Relay
Texas Instruments TPSI2260-Q1 Reinforced Solid-State Relay is designed for high-voltage automotive and industrial applications. The isolated solid-state relay implements high-reliability reinforced capacitive isolation technology, merged with internal back-to-back MOSFETs, to form a completely integrated solution that requires no secondary-side power supply. TI's capacitive isolation technology does not exhibit mechanical wearout or photo-degradation failure modes common to mechanical relays and photo relays, thereby enhancing system reliability. The primary side of the TPSI2260-Q1 draws only 5mA of input current and incorporates a fail-safe EN pin that prevents back-powering the VDD supply. The VDD pin of the device should be connected to a system supply between 4.5V and 20V, and the EN pin should be driven by a GPIO output with a logic high between 2.1V and 20V in most applications. Furthermore, in other applications, the VDD and EN pins could be driven together directly from the system supply or from a GPIO output. The secondary side incorporates back-to-back MOSFETs with a standoff voltage of ±600V from S1 to S2.
